Transaction 561863e21ebaaf9ffaf7288c252ac7518ba3e087c183ab2bd25044bbed8c122e

1 Input
2 Outputs
  • 561863e21ebaaf9ffaf7288c252ac7518ba3e087c183ab2bd25044bbed8c122e:0
  • value  428000
    address  3G9kuycFm5vNK8Fmy5JgGtHYJERgGJPh6E
  • 561863e21ebaaf9ffaf7288c252ac7518ba3e087c183ab2bd25044bbed8c122e:1
  • value  155853541
    address  12wtQCtZVoThvypg6TJ3xSMBwDPLUTHBAi